Hello,

I've looked around the forum and the eyez-on portal to see if this is possible but had not come across the answer.

I have 5 partitions and several users. I'm currently using the free version but would gladly upgrade if this is a feature of a paid service.

I need to notify one of my employees of arm/disarm notices specific to partition 5. I would hate to bug him with notices for other partitions though as they do not relate to his job function.

Some of these partitions are for other parts of the building our company does not operate (tenant common areas). I would prefer that no one receive arm/disarm notices for zones 3 and 4 as these are irrelevant. Is this level of granularity available somewhere or am I asking too much?

Thanks!

Yes, "sharing" by partition is an Envisalerts+ feature. Your employee could create their own Eyezon account and you could share partition 5 with them. Your employee would then create their own alerts conacts that will only receive alerts associated with partition 5.
